Acronyms, Abbreviations, and Initialisms.
All human edited and we add more daily

The meaning of the Acronym IMBP is...

IMBP is

  • Immobilized Mismatch Binding Protein

More Meanings For IMBP:

  • Institute of Medical and Biological Problems
  • Institute of Molecular Bioimaging and Physiology
  • Internet Marketing Business Plan
  • IIMEX Merchant Banking Partner
  • I Might Be Pregnant
  • Immobilized Mismatch Binding Protein

IMBP is also in:

Acronym Definition Searched: 30819 36612 TBQ IVJ WFGA PDI-P HG 43451 WATA WCOB MPTP BIOM VA OHQ 49509